Are Alarm Bells Ringing in the World of Artificial Intelligence?
Safety and ethics warnings from researchers leaving artificial intelligence companies raise questions about the rules governing increasingly powerful systems and who gets to decide them. The article does not treat critical resignations as proof of an imminent catastrophe and stresses that comprehensive data showing an industry-wide acceleration in departures are lacking. For agents capable of taking action, it argues that safety must be assessed not just through model performance but also through restricted permissions, human approval, error detection, reversibility and the ability to stop the system. The commercialization of privacy, the transfer of value from original content creators to platforms and dependence on a handful of critical infrastructure providers are examined through the lenses of digital feudalism and technological sovereignty. It advocates cautious optimism that preserves the benefits of the technology while strengthening independent testing, genuine accountability, safe channels for employee warnings and meaningful human oversight.
The Imperial Power of the Digital Age: Data Colonialism and Artificial Intelligence
Power in the artificial intelligence ecosystem is measured not merely by market share, but by influence over knowledge, ethics and politics. The article argues that colonial extraction, once directed at raw materials, now targets human cognition, language, culture and behavioral data. When local knowledge is stripped of context, it becomes a resource that global platforms can process and monetize. Claims of sovereign artificial intelligence remain incomplete while chips and cloud infrastructure depend on foreign suppliers. Genuine digital sovereignty therefore requires an integrated strategy spanning critical minerals, semiconductors, data, models, energy and infrastructure.
Artificial Intelligence Sovereignty, Domestic Infrastructure and the Supply Chain
Sovereignty in artificial intelligence is about far more than developing a domestic model or chatbot. Data centers, cooling systems, energy, subsea cables, chips and critical minerals are all parts of the same strategic equation. Nvidia’s influence in accelerators, TSMC’s manufacturing capacity and China’s strength in rare-earth processing create global chokepoints. Türkiye’s defense-sector localization experience, together with infrastructure such as ARF ACC, provides a valuable foundation, yet hardware dependence persists. The article proposes a model of modular autonomy encompassing domestic orchestration software, cybersecurity, strategic public procurement and technology diplomacy.
The Scientific Community’s Test with Artificial Intelligence
Generative artificial intelligence is forcing science to reconsider authorship, originality and research integrity. As tools take over research, analysis and writing, the researcher can shift from author to curator or editor. Divergent regulatory approaches in the European Union, the United States and China create new compliance challenges for international research partnerships. Paper mills, fabricated data and images, and unreliable detection tools make scholarly publishing more vulnerable. The article favors transparency, access to raw data and clear disclosure of research processes over blanket bans, while examples such as AlphaFold and GNoME demonstrate the technology’s scientific value.

Dependence on Artificial Intelligence and Its Psychological Effects
Constantly offloading cognitive work to artificial intelligence tools may weaken memory, attention, deep reasoning and critical judgment. The risks of digital amnesia and skill atrophy are particularly pronounced for students. Dependence on generative artificial intelligence can produce patterns associated with behavioral addiction, including preoccupation, withdrawal and continued use despite harmful consequences. Variable rewards, gamification and systems designed to flatter users may intensify psychological risks for vulnerable people. The article calls for ethical design, clear educational boundaries and disciplined personal use.
From Adopter to Innovator: Türkiye’s Strategic AI Initiatives for National Security and Inclusive Growth
In an increasingly technopolar world, artificial intelligence capacity has become a decisive factor in national competitiveness, security and international influence. Drawing on policy documents and case studies, the article examines Türkiye’s transition from technology adopter to active innovator in critical sectors such as defense, healthcare and education. Investment in human capital, equitable access to opportunity and robust data governance emerge as essential conditions for narrowing the digital divide and advancing inclusive growth. The study also assesses the role of artificial intelligence-driven defense modernization in building strategic autonomy and resilience against emerging threats. It recommends stronger cross-sector partnerships and investment in critical infrastructure to balance economic development, social equity and national security.
